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 149.48 cc 155.00 cc
Engine 4-Step, DOHC, 4-Valve, Single Cylinder Liquid-cooled, 4-stroke, SOHC, 4-valve
Engine Starting Pedal & Electrical Electric
Clutch Multiple Wet Clutch Coil Spring Wet, multiple-disc
Fuel System PGM-FI Fuel injection
Cooling System Liquid Cooled with Auto Fan Liquid-cooled
Maximum Power 16.9 bhp @ 9000 rpm 18.6 PS @ 10000 RPM
Maximum Torque 13.8 Nm @ 7000 rpm 14.1 Nm @ 8500 RPM
Transmission 6-Speed Constant mesh, 6-speed
Gear Shift Pattern 1-N-2-3-4-5-6 1-N-2-3-4-5-6
Top Speed 125 kmph --
Battery -- 12V, 4.0Ah
Frame Diamond (Truss) Frame Deltabox
Headlamp -- LED
Taillamp -- LED
Mileage
Highway Mileage 50 kmpl --
City Mileage 45 kmpl --
Tyres
Front 80/90 - 17M / C 44P (tubeless) 100/80-17M/C 52P - Tubeless
Rear 100/80 - 17M / C 52P (tubeless) 140/70R17M/C 66H - Radial Tubeless
Wheel / RIM -- Alloy
Brakes
Front Hydraulic disc, with double piston 282 mm Disc brake
Rear Hydraulic disc, with Single Piston 220 mm Disc brake
ABS -- Dual channel ABS
Suspension
Front Telescopic Telescopic fork
Rear Swing Arm with Suspension Single (Pro-Link Suspension System) Monocross (link suspension)
Colors Available
Colors Red, Black, White, Orange. RACING BLUE
THUNDER GREY
DARK KNIGHT


Physical Specs
Length 2008 mm 1990 mm
Width 719 mm 725 mm
Height 1061 mm 1135 mm
Weight 129 kg 142 kg
Seat Height -- 815
Wheelbase 1288 mm 1325 mm
Ground Clearance 148 mm 170 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 12 litres 11 litres
